Output 075c021635f09f771e0675c2f9d81c4e2f72bbc9d489c992ee7ac847068dd030:1

value
6962239864029
script pubkey
OP_0 OP_PUSHBYTES_20 c3785d10aeacae16fb65774237d930b5b9811095
address
tb1qcdu96y9w4jhpd7m9wapr0kfskkuczyy466zgec
transaction
075c021635f09f771e0675c2f9d81c4e2f72bbc9d489c992ee7ac847068dd030
confirmations
173856
spent
true